Abstract

This article analyzes the change of Hani village residents' ecological concept after the success of application for world heritage of terraces via summarizing their "living with the nature" ecological concept based on site survey and with consideration of outside culture effect. This article takes the theory of sustainable development to consider how the Hani residents could enhance the ecological progress in the terrace area with their new ecological concept and tries to provide relevant development policies regarding mode of thinking, mode of economic development and "Beautiful Home Construction" etc.
